Skip to content

Commit 84205a1

Browse files
committed
build: update react version
1 parent 67c0d64 commit 84205a1

9 files changed

+746
-810
lines changed

.eslintrc.cjs

Lines changed: 0 additions & 18 deletions
This file was deleted.

README.md

Lines changed: 10 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
<!-- PROJECT PRESENTATION -->
22
<div align="center">
3-
<a href="https://github.com/misicode/DictionaryApp">
3+
<a href="https://github.com/misicode/Dictionary_App">
44
<img src="./public/favicon.ico" alt="Logo Icon" width="80" height="80">
55
</a>
66

@@ -10,9 +10,9 @@
1010
<span>Aplicación de diccionario</span><br>
1111
<a href="https://misicode-dictionary.netlify.app">Ver Demo</a>
1212
|
13-
<a href="https://github.com/misicode/DictionaryApp/issues">Reportar Bug</a>
13+
<a href="https://github.com/misicode/Dictionary_App/issues">Reportar Bug</a>
1414
|
15-
<a href="https://github.com/misicode/DictionaryApp/issues">Solicitar Feature</a>
15+
<a href="https://github.com/misicode/Dictionary_App/issues">Solicitar Feature</a>
1616
</p>
1717
</div><br>
1818

@@ -26,12 +26,12 @@ Aplicación web desarrollada con React que consume la API de [Free Dictionary][d
2626

2727
| Herramienta | Descripción | Versión |
2828
| ------------------------------------------------- | ----------------------------------------------------------------- | ------- |
29-
| [![React][react-badge]][react-url] | Biblioteca de JavaScript para construir las interfaces de usuario | 18.2.0 |
30-
| [![Vite][vite-badge]][vite-url] | Herramienta de Frontend para construir el proyecto | 5.2.0 |
31-
| [![TypeScript][typescript-badge]][typescript-url] | Lenguaje de programación fuertemente tipado para escribir código | 5.2.2 |
29+
| [![React][react-badge]][react-url] | Biblioteca de JavaScript para construir las interfaces de usuario | 18.3.1 |
30+
| [![Vite][vite-badge]][vite-url] | Herramienta de Frontend para construir el proyecto | 5.4.10 |
31+
| [![TypeScript][typescript-badge]][typescript-url] | Lenguaje de programación fuertemente tipado para escribir código | 5.6.2 |
3232
| [![SonarQube][sonarqube-badge]][sonarqube-url] | Plataforma para evaluar el código fuente | 10.5 |
3333
| [![NPM][npm-badge]][npm-url] | Administrador de paquetes para instalar las dependencias | 10.5.0 |
34-
| [![Visual Studio Code][vsc-badge]][vsc-url] | Editor de código para el proyecto | 1.89.1 |
34+
| [![Visual Studio Code][vsc-badge]][vsc-url] | Editor de código para el proyecto | 1.95.1 |
3535

3636
### Vista previa
3737

@@ -66,7 +66,7 @@ Visual Studio Code
6666
2. Descargue o clone este repositorio.
6767

6868
```sh
69-
git clone https://github.com/misicode/DictionaryApp.git
69+
git clone https://github.com/misicode/Dictionary_App.git
7070
```
7171

7272
3. Instale todos los paquetes NPM.
@@ -140,7 +140,7 @@ _Desarrollado por_ **Alessandra Mincia**
140140
<!-- ACKNOWLEDGMENTS -->
141141
## 📝 Agradecimientos
142142

143-
La idea de este proyecto surgió como iniciativa del workshop "SheCodes React", de [SheCodes][shecodes-url]. Para obtener más información detallada de este programa visite el siguiente [enlace][shecodes-react-url].
143+
La idea de este proyecto surgió como iniciativa del workshop "SheCodes React", de [SheCodes][shecodes-url].
144144

145145

146146
<!-- MARKDOWN LINKS -->
@@ -165,5 +165,4 @@ La idea de este proyecto surgió como iniciativa del workshop "SheCodes React",
165165
[github-url]: https://github.com/misicode
166166
[linkedin-badge]: https://img.shields.io/badge/LinkedIn-0A66C2?logo=linkedin&logoColor=fff
167167
[linkedin-url]: https://www.linkedin.com/in/misicode
168-
[shecodes-url]: https://www.shecodes.io
169-
[shecodes-react-url]: https://www.shecodes.io/react
168+
[shecodes-url]: https://www.shecodes.io

eslint.config.js

Lines changed: 28 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,28 @@
1+
import js from "@eslint/js";
2+
import globals from "globals";
3+
import reactHooks from "eslint-plugin-react-hooks";
4+
import reactRefresh from "eslint-plugin-react-refresh";
5+
import tseslint from "typescript-eslint";
6+
7+
export default tseslint.config(
8+
{ ignores: ["dist"] },
9+
{
10+
extends: [js.configs.recommended, ...tseslint.configs.recommended],
11+
files: ["**/*.{ts,tsx}"],
12+
languageOptions: {
13+
ecmaVersion: 2020,
14+
globals: globals.browser,
15+
},
16+
plugins: {
17+
"react-hooks": reactHooks,
18+
"react-refresh": reactRefresh,
19+
},
20+
rules: {
21+
...reactHooks.configs.recommended.rules,
22+
"react-refresh/only-export-components": [
23+
"warn",
24+
{ allowConstantExport: true },
25+
],
26+
},
27+
}
28+
);

0 commit comments

Comments
 (0)